MonsterInsights was originally developed by Joost de Valk, the developer behind Yoast SEO . As Yoast grew, they decided to focus exclusively on SEO products, and the Google Analytics by Yoast plugin found a new home in 2016 with Syed Balkhi and was rebranded as MonsterInsights.
MonsterInsights now has one goal: to make analytics easier for beginners.
MonsterInsights is created by the same team behind WPBeginner , OptinMonster , and WPForms .

How to set up MonsterInsights
Note : You will need to have a Google Analytics account already canadian ceo created before setting up this plugin.
Install and activate the plugin, then navigate to Insights » Settings . Here you can connect your Google Analytics account without having to edit any code.
Connect MonsterInsights
Click Connect MonsterInsights to get started.
In the pop-up window that appears, select the Google account you used to create your Google Analytics account.
After that, you need to click on the Allow button to grant MonsterInsights access to your analytics data.
Now you can select an analysis profile from the drop-down list and click the Complete Connection button .
Select analytics profile in MonsterInsights
MonsterInsights will automatically connect your website to your Google Analytics account. After that, you’ll be redirected to your WordPress dashboard where you can customize what you want to track.
On the Insights » Settings page , you will see different tabs in the top menu that allow you to customize settings for engagement, ecommerce, publishers, and conversions.
Customize MonsterInsights
By exploring these tabs, you'll see all of MonsterInsights' available features and customization options, such as:
Demographics and Interest Reports : This will give you insights into your target audience that will help you remarket and advertise with better results.
Anonymize IPs : This will help to anonymize the IP addresses of visitors.
Scroll Tracking : This will show you how far your visitors scroll down your website.
Enable enhanced link attribution : If you have multiple links to the same destination on a page, this will show you which link gets the most clicks.
Cross-domain tracking : This allows you to view sessions on two related websites as a single session.
Google AdSense Tracking : This allows you to connect your Google AdSense account to track the performance of your ads.
Email summaries and PDF downloads : Sends you weekly summaries of your website's most important analytics. You can also download the analytics report as a PDF file to share or use offline.
User Permissions : This allows you to determine who can view reports and change settings.
When you're done customizing what you want MonsterInsights to track and report on, save your changes to store your settings.
Next, you can view the MonsterInsights report to see your website’s analytics. To do this, you’ll need to visit Insights » Reports to see the traffic statistics displayed.
